Senior Management Team
EIRIS’ Senior Management brings a wealth of experience in responsible investment leadership and expertise. The team is responsible for the management of EIRIS, leads on the strategic development of its global research and oversees management of its international client base.
- Peter Webster, Executive Director
Peter Webster has been Executive Director of EIRIS since its foundation in the 1980s, and has been involved in the promotion and development of responsible investment in its various forms throughout the last 25 years. Peter is a regular conference speaker as well as advising clients on the creation or development of new approaches to responsible investment.
His current interests in this field include how PRI signatories can implement the commitments they sign up to in ways that make a significant difference to corporate performance and reporting across all the Global Compact issues (Environment, Human Rights, Labour Standards and Combating Bribery); the most effective role investors can play in advancing the Climate Change agenda; and what can be learnt from the experience of responsible investors and the models of corporate responsibility that they have encouraged that is of relevance to the re-structuring of the present international financial system to re-build trust and confidence, and reduce the prospect of future 'crunches'.
Peter is Treasurer of the UK Sustainable Investment and Finance association (UKSIF).
